Schottky Diode
Schottky Diode (also called Schottky Barrier Diode or Hot Carrier Diodes), discovered by German physicist Walter H. Schottky, is a special type of diode in which the P-layer(of PN junction) is replaced by the metal layer(i.e. Aluminium, Tungsten, Molybdenum, Platinum, Chromium etc.), while the N layer is of silicon(semiconductor - ...

Today, I am going to unlock the details on the Introduction to 2sa1015. It is a low frequency PNP (positive-negative-positive) bipolar junction transistor which is mainly used for general purpose amplification. It mainly consists of N doped semiconductor which exists between the two layers of P doped material.
